Summary
Abstract:
This layer represents *generalized* boundaries of Important Bird Areas (IBA) in
Canada. IBAs, in Canada and elsewhere, are evaluated and designated on the basis of internationally established criteria. The polygons contained in the dataset meet these criteria and are therefore deemed significant at the national, continental, or global level.
